5 Benefits of a Roof Ridge Cap for Your Home

A roof ridge cap, the protective seal on the highest point of your roof, safeguards your home from heavy rain, hail, snow, and harsh sunlight. This vital roofing component covers the ridge of your roof, fortifying one of the most vulnerable sections of your exterior. 

A ridge cap is often made of asphalt shingles that overlap to create a waterproof barrier along your roof’s peak. Other options include a prefabricated cap made of metal, aluminum, copper, or thick plastic. What Is a Ridge Cap?

Ridge caps are thicker than typical asphalt shingles, and they are pre-bent to fit the shape of your roof’s peak. Their design ensures your roof’s peak resists leaks and damage, and safeguards your home from harmful moisture intrusion. 

Types of Ridge Caps

  • Solid – This type of ridge cap delivers a seamless, crisp look, enhancing your home’s curb appeal.
  • Vented – With openings that allow air to circulate into your attic, a vented ridge cap creates the optimal conditions for your attic and roof to breathe, lengthening the lifespan of your roof. 

Problems You’ll Avoid by Installing a Ridge Cap During Your Roof Replacement

Since the ridge is the highest point of your home and a location where two seams meet, it is more susceptible to damage from weather. Without a ridge cap, your roof would be more vulnerable to leaks, cracks, mold and mildew, decreasing its lifespan and increasing the need for costly repairs. Without the protection a ridge cap provides, your roof ridge would be more prone to wind uplift and shingle damage, lowering the possibility that it will last as long as it was designed to.

Advantages of Installing a Ridge Cap on Your Roof 

1. Enhance Ventilation

A ridge cap is an aesthetically pleasing ventilation option that keeps your roof and attic in optimal shape by allowing air to circulate freely. With proper ridge cap installation, warm air escapes from your attic during the summer and moist air escapes during the winter. This helps regulate your attic’s temperature and moisture level, reducing the risk of mold and creating the best conditions for a healthy, long-lasting roof. 

2. Protect Against Weather-Related Damage

Safeguarding your roof with a ridge cap is a smart choice, particularly with the weather we face throughout the year in Wichita. Properly installed ridge caps withstand high winds, rain, snow, and ice, protecting your house against conditions that could expose your roof to damaging water intrusion. 

3. Extend the Life of Your Roof

Your roof will last longer when you have a ridge cap installed during your roof replacement because it safeguards the most vulnerable area of your roof where the slopes meet. Your entire roof is more likely to stay in good condition when you have a ridge cap installed, delaying the need for your next roof replacement. 

4. Prevent Roof Leaks

Your ridge line is a location where water can seep under roofing if it’s not protected properly. A ridge cap shields this at-risk area and keeps rain, snow, ice, and more from penetrating your roof and causing costly damage. 

5. Enhance Your Home’s Curb Appeal

When curb appeal increases, your home’s value increases. A ridge cap elevates the visual appeal of your roof, creating a polished and finished look to your home exterior. 

Maintain Your Ridge Cap for Optimal Performance 

The top of your house takes the brunt of the Wichita weather that impacts it. This can include unforgiving rain, snow, hail, ice, and high winds. Since your ridge cap does the heavy lifting of protecting your home’s peak, it’s vital to take good care of it over the life of your roof. Here are some tips for its upkeep: 

Periodic Inspections

From the safety of the ground, inspect your ridge cap by using a pair of binoculars to see that it is in good working order. Look for signs of water damage, wear and tear, or loose components. If you see anything compromised about its appearance, contact a reputable roofer for a professional inspection

Ventilation

If you have a ventilated ridge cap, while inspecting it from the ground, check if the openings are clear or not. They need to remain clear so your home can maintain proper attic ventilation. If channels look clogged, don’t take the risk of climbing on your roof to try to fix it. Contact a trusted roofer to address the issue.
